Description

Made for long summer days on the lake, this fast charging 12V solar panel is built for adventure. In full sun it will charge a Powerbox 10 in 3-4 hours, or a 7Ah battery in just 2.5 hours! Rated at 50 watts this panel provides 150% more juice then our standard solar panel, while also being waterproof, shatterproof, and half the weight. Alligator clips provide universal compatibility. This panel will charge any 12V Dakota Lithium battery. Can be used while power is being drawn from the battery (in effect you can power some electronics indefinitely). Use multiple panels for a faster charging time or for charging bigger capacity batteries.

Technical Specifications

  • Power: 50 Watts, Maximum Power Current is 2.8 Amps
  • How Long to Charge My Battery?: Divide the Ah (capacity) of your battery by 2.8 to determine how many hours to charge your battery. For example, a Powerbox 10 has 10 amps, divide by 2.8 = 3.5 hours. Connect two solar panels to double the charging speed.
  • Size Folded: 11 in. x 16 in. x 1.0 inches folded. Small enough to fit in a pack. Big enough to fully charge your battery.
  • Size Unfolded: 33 in. x 16 in. x 1.0 (While in Use)
  • Compatibility & Connection: Charges any 12v Dakota Lithium battery with universal alligator clips. Clips stow away in a zippered pocket when not in use.
  • Rugged Design: Waterproof, Weatherproof, Shatterproof. All protected by a military spec nylon case.
  • Weight: 2 lbs 13 oz
  • Maximum Power Voltage: 18 Volts
  • Solar Cell Type: Monocrystalline (a very flexible, lightweight, and durable solar cell)
  • Stand Included: Legs fold out to optimize the angle to the sun.

This is my very first foray into anything solar. In my application, which is portable ham radio, I need a way to keep my batteries topped when away from the grid. After reading the info on the website and asking way too many questions (all of which were promptly responded to) I decided to try the 50W folding solar panel. When the box arrived I was dismayed at its size. I guess Dakota have heard about the perils of common carriers- the package was almost three times as large as the panel which contributed to its safe arrival. What is amazing is that the panel captures energy, in late afternoon, in early January, inside my family room, through the twin seal glass unit with louvers between the glass panels. Astounding. I think this will work. Fred VE7FMN
